Warren Harmon Lewis (June 17, 1870 – July 3, 1964) was an American embryologist and cell biologist. He became professor of physiological anatomy at the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ine in 1913 and from 1919 to 1940, he worked along with his wife Margaret Reed Lewis at the Carnegie Institute of Washington.
